Watched Words als Befehl-Shortcut zum Einfügen von Links

Entschuldigen Sie mein Englisch, ich benutze Google Translate

Ich habe WordPress verlassen, um zu Discourse zu wechseln, und habe viel Entwicklung gesehen, ich bin sehr zufrieden mit Discourse. Aber es gibt eine Funktion, die meine Mitglieder an WordPress sehr vermissen
Es wäre großartig, wenn Sie es erstellen könnten, jeder bei Discourse wird es lieben!

In WordPress gibt es ein sehr interessantes Plugin, dieses Plugin funktioniert so: Sie gehen in das Textfeld, klicken auf das Wort GIF, und es öffnet sich ein Menü. In diesem Menü fügen Sie den Link zu einem beliebigen GIF mit einem Befehl ein, den Sie im Textfeld verwenden möchten. Zum Beispiel speichere ich einen Link zu einem weinenden GIF mit dem Befehl LOL3. Jedes Mal, wenn ich LOL3 in das Textfeld eingebe, erscheint automatisch das von mir gespeicherte GIF, ohne dass ich nach dem Link suchen und ihn in das Textfeld einfügen muss! Um die GIFs leichter zu finden, erscheint beim Speichern eine Miniaturansicht (damit Sie nicht vergessen, welches GIF zu welchem Befehl gehört). Ich werde Ihnen ein Video hinterlassen, damit Sie es besser sehen können:

Nichts wird in Discourse gespeichert, es ist nur ein Link-Aufrufer mit Befehl/Phrasen

Ich habe gesehen, dass es in Discourse eine Option für “Watched Words” gibt, bei der ich einen Satz durch einen anderen ersetzen kann, aber diese Option kann nur von Administratoren verwendet werden (sollte für alle freigegeben werden) und wenn ich einen Befehl (Satz) verwende, um ihn durch einen Link zu ersetzen, wird dieser Link nicht in den Text eingebettet und auch das GIF des von mir gespeicherten Links erscheint nicht, was die Suche erschwert.

Ich kann einen Befehl (Phrase) mit einem GIF-Link speichern
Wäre es möglich, “Watched Words” für alle freizugeben? Und gibt es eine Möglichkeit, die Links, die Leute in “Watched Words” verwenden, einzubetten und die GIFs der gespeicherten Links erscheinen zu lassen, um die Suche zu erleichtern?

Ich kann einen Befehl (Phrase) mit einem GIF-Link speichern (aber er ist nicht für alle Forenbenutzer freigegeben)

Wenn der GIF-Link gespeichert wird, erscheint keine GIF-Miniaturansicht, um ihn später zu finden (da in WordPress Leute mehr als 500 GIFs gespeichert hatten, würde das Erscheinen der GIF-Miniaturansicht die Suche erleichtern)

Es wäre interessant, wenn die mit Befehl/Phrasen gespeicherten Links mit Miniaturansichten erscheinen würden, um die Suche zu erleichtern

Wenn ich den Befehl/Phrase “oi” verwende, wird er automatisch durch den Link ersetzt, den ich in “Watched Words” eingegeben habe, aber der Link bettet das GIF nicht in das Textfeld ein. Es wäre schön, wenn er es tun würde

In meinem Land sind GIFs sehr kulturell, jeder benutzt ein anderes GIF oder Meme, jeder hat seine eigene GIF- und Meme-Ordner zum Benutzen! Diese Funktion erleichtert die Nutzung in Foren erheblich und reduziert die Bürokratie für Handy-Nutzer, da sie nur den Befehl eingeben müssen und nicht nach GIF-Links suchen müssen.

1 „Gefällt mir“

Ich weiß nicht, ob du gut genug bist ReplyGif: Einfaches Hinzufügen von Reaktions-GIFs

Hallo Freund, wie gut, dass du Portugiesisch sprichst, dann muss ich nicht Google Translate benutzen und mich hier mit bizarren Übersetzungen zum Narren machen, lol
Ich habe also WordPress durch Discourse ersetzt, und das war ein Aufstieg vom Müll zum Luxus, aber in WordPress gab es ein sehr interessantes Tool/Plugin, das meine Forenmitglieder jeden Tag von mir verlangen, es dort einzubauen

Es ist nichts anderes als ein Menü, das sich in der Textbox befindet. Wenn Sie auf dieses Menü klicken, haben Sie die Möglichkeit, den Link Ihrer GIFs zu speichern, indem Sie einen Befehl zum Aufrufen festlegen. Zum Beispiel füge ich das GIF von Gretchen, die weint, ein und der Befehl lautet gretchoro1, so dass jedes Mal, wenn ich gretchoro1 schreibe, das GIF in die Textbox eingefügt wird, und damit ich sehe, welches GIF ich für jeden Befehl eingefügt habe, öffne ich einfach das Menü und sehe die Miniaturansichten der GIFs

Sie sagten mir also, dass es dieses ReplyGif gibt, das dasselbe ist, aber ich konnte es nicht benutzen

Ich habe gesehen, dass es in Discourse die Watched Words gibt. Nun, ich kann ein Wort (Beispiel Choro2) durch einen GIF-Link ersetzen, aber das Problem ist, dass dieser GIF-Link nicht in die Textbox eingebettet wird, und nur Admins können ihn benutzen und man kann auch nicht die Miniaturansichten der GIFs im Menü sehen, nur den Link des GIFs.

Wenn ich so etwas machen wollte, was müsste ich studieren? Ist das Programmieren?

@Falco

Nein, das ist er nicht.

Ja. Das erfordert ein Plugin mit angemessener Komplexität.

Wenn sie diese Funktion wirklich wollen, ist der Weg, einen einmaligen https://apoia.se/ einzurichten, um Geld zu sammeln und jemanden zu bezahlen, der sie im Marketplace erstellt.

Far from being the same thing, but are you already using the theme component that allows you to search for GIFs and insert them when composing a post?

As far as I understood from Pandlr’s “GIF Pocket”, it allows you to have a list of favorite GIFs per user, is that right?

I ask because with a solution similar to Watched Words, only admins could define automatic replacement terms, it wouldn’t be a per-user archive.

Ich kannte diese Unterstützungsseite nicht, ich werde zuerst sehen, wie viel es kostet, eine zu erstellen, und dann werde ich mich darum kümmern!

Ich habe gerade deinen Kommentar gelesen und dachte mir: „Mein Gott, wie gut Google Translate das übersetzt hat“ hahaha
Das ist richtig, dieser „Gifpocket“ ist ein Bereich in der Textbox, in dem du deine bevorzugten GIF-Links als Favoriten speichern kannst (sie werden als Miniaturansichten angezeigt) und sie mit einem Befehl verwenden kannst, z. B. „weinen1“, „tschüss2“, „lachen4“ oder jedes Wort, das du verwenden möchtest!
Es ist wie die „Watched Words“-Funktion, die es in Discourse bereits gibt, bei der du ein Wort eingibst und es durch ein anderes Wort ersetzt wird. In diesem Fall würdest du ein Wort eingeben, das durch den Link zum GIF ersetzt wird, das das GIF in den Beitrag einbettet.
Das Problem bei den „Watched Words“ ist, dass nur Administratoren sie verwenden können, die aufgerufenen Links werden nicht eingebettet und in der Sitzung werden die GIFs nicht angezeigt, nur die Links (was es schwierig macht zu sehen, welche GIFs der Benutzer gespeichert hat).

Dann versuchten meine Mitglieder, diese Discourse-Gifs zu verwenden, aber sie mochten sie nicht, fanden sie zu verwirrend, einige hatten Probleme mit der Synchronisation, und sie sind es gewohnt, Befehle zu verwenden, wie z. B. hundverrückt, katzenlauern, kinderschreien.

Kannst du das machen? Wie viel würdest du verlangen? Denn ich kann mich mit den Mitgliedern meines Forums beraten, um Geld dafür aufzutreiben.

Selbst wenn Sie etwas mit der Wortsubstitution machen, scheint der GIF-Selektor eine gute Idee zu sein, da er nicht auf die von den Admins definierte Menge beschränkt ist.

Bei BCharts verwendeten sie discourse-reactions mit benutzerdefinierten Emojis, um Reaktionen mit Mini-Memes zu haben, aber sie sind nicht animiert und sehr klein.

Hmmm, ich denke darüber nach, dass es eine Theme-Komponente gibt, die fast das tut, was Sie wollen (unter der Annahme, dass die Wörter nur von Admins definiert werden): Auto-Linkify Words

Ich habe nur geändert, um Bilder anstelle von Links zu erstellen, es gibt nicht einmal das Pause/Resume von Discourse Gifs, der Rest des Codes ist absolut identisch mit der ursprünglichen Theme-Komponente, aber Sie können sie installieren, wenn Sie sie ausprobieren möchten: GitHub - renato/discourse-imgify-words: theme to auto imgify urls in discourse, almost the same as discourse-linkify-works

Beispiel mit

chorolivre, https://media0.giphy.com/media/k61nOBRRBMxva/200.webp
palmas, https://media0.giphy.com/media/26gsspfbt1HfVQ9va/200.webp

in der Konfiguration von words to imgify:

Screen_Recording_2022-10-26_at_14_48_26_AdobeExpress

Beachten Sie, dass es sich um eine Theme-Komponente und nicht um ein Plugin handelt. Daher muss die Installation diesem Leitfaden folgen. Aus diesem Grund erfolgt die Ersetzung nur in der Weboberfläche. In E-Mails oder an anderen Orten wird das ursprüngliche Wort angezeigt.

Keine Garantie meinerseits, okay? Es war ein schneller Test und etwas, das ich in meiner Community nützlich finden könnte, aber leider kann ich derzeit keinen Support oder andere Anpassungen anbieten (dafür bleibt der Vorschlag, in Marketplace zu posten).

1 „Gefällt mir“

Wow, ich fand das sehr interessant und sehr cool, schade, dass nur Administratoren es nutzen können. Ich werde sehen, ob ich jemanden finde, der es für alle nutzbar macht, aber das ist sehr cool, herzlichen Glückwunsch.

Um nur zur Klarstellung, nur Administratoren können die zu konvertierenden Wörter festlegen, aber alle Benutzer können sie verwenden.

Ja, das habe ich auch gesehen, schade =(